Lotus Taps KEF for Premium Car Audio System

The Lotus KEF partnership has created a premium car audio system for the new Lotus Elmira. LS50s in a Lotus?

Lotus Emira

Lotus and KEF have announced a partnership to bring high-end audio into the next generation of Lotus sports cars and premium electric lifestyle vehicles, commencing with the new Lotus Emira.

KEF has drawn on its 60 years of audio mastery to create company’s first ever automotive partnership. Debuting in Lotus Emira is a 10-channel premium car audio sound system featuring KEF’s signature Uni-QTM speaker technology that acoustically blends the speaker drive units into the car interior to ensure a truly spatial sound experience.

KEF Uni-Q

Deployed for the first time in a production car,  KEF’s Uni-QTM technology combines the tweeter and mid-range drivers into a single unit the covers the entire mid and high-frequency sound spectrum from a single point in space. KEF claims this speaker technology delivers a more coherent, hyper-realistic sound experience.

Access to the car’s infotainment system is via a 10.25-inch centrally mounted touch-screen, with an additional 12.3-inch TFT driver’s display behind the steering wheel. All content is exclusive to Lotus has been designed and developed by an in-house team. Android Auto and Apple CarPlay are integrated as standard.

The premium car audio market has become very competitive with McIntosh/Jeep, and Sonos/Audi offering brand new systems in 2021.
